Government debt and deficit, 3rd quarter 2009
According to Statistics Estonia, the Estonian general government sector surplused in the 3rd quarter 2009 by 1.4 billion kroons. The consolidated gross debt level rose up to 13.8 billion kroons.

Foreign trade, October 2009
According to Statistics Estonia, in October 2009 exports of goods from Estonia at current prices totalled about 9 billion kroons and imports to Estonia amounted to 9.8 billion kroons. Exports to Russia declined the most compared to October 2008.

The census rehearsal of the 2011 Population Census will begin on the last day of the year
According to Statistics Estonia, the pilot Census of the 2011 Population and Housing Census (REL 2011) will take place in nine local governments of Estonia from 31 December until 31 March. The organisation, methodology and information system of the Census will be tested. For the first time the opportunity for electronic enumeration on the Internet is provided.

Gross domestic product, 3rd quarter 2009
According to the first estimates of Statistics Estonia, the gross domestic product (GDP) of Estonia decreased by 15.6% in the 3rd quarter of 2009 compared to the same quarter in the previous year. The GDP decreased successively for seven quarters, still the decrease decelerated in the 3rd quarter.

Expenditures of research and development activity, 2008
According to Statistics Estonia, 3.2 billion kroons were spent on research and development in Estonia in 2008. This amount is over three times more compared to 2003.
